Getting There

  • Public Transport

    From Larnaca, take the 408 bus towards Kofinou. From Nicosia, take the bus to Alampra and then the 405 bus to Skarinou. Get off at the 'Skarinou Cemetery 1' bus stop. From there, it's approximately a 15-20 minute walk to Dipotamos Donkey Farm. Follow the main road through the village, watching for signs. Bus fare from Larnaca to Skarinou is approximately €3-€5. Bus fare from Nicosia to Alampra is approximately €4-€6.

  • Driving

    If driving from Larnaca or Nicosia, take the A1 motorway towards Limassol. Exit at Skarinou and follow the signs to the village center. From the center of Skarinou, follow local road signs for Dipotamos Donkey Farm. Parking is available near the farm entrance and is typically free. Several hotels in Skarinou offer free parking.

  • Taxi

    Taxis are available from major towns like Larnaca and Nicosia. A taxi from Larnaca to Skarinou will cost approximately €35-€45 and the journey takes around 25 minutes. From the Skarinou village center, follow local road signs for Dipotamos Donkey Farm. The taxi can drop you off near the entrance.

Discover more about Dipotamos Donkey Farm

Dipotamos Donkey Farm, nestled in the tranquil village of Skarinou, offers a heartwarming journey into Cyprus's rural heritage. More than just a farm, it's a sanctuary dedicated to the preservation and celebration of the Cypriot donkey, an animal integral to the island's history for centuries. Founded in 2002 by Pieris Georgiades, Dipotamos Donkey Farm provides a home for neglected animals, aiming to protect donkeys whose numbers dwindled with modern technology. Visitors can learn about their history, habits, and vital role in shaping Cyprus's agricultural landscape. The farm's origins trace back to a deep appreciation for the island's traditions. As you enter the farm, you're greeted by the sight of donkeys roaming freely in a picturesque setting. The air is filled with the sounds of rural life, offering a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of tourist hotspots. Visitors can wander through olive groves, enjoy a picnic, or simply observe the animals in their natural habitat. The farm also features a small heritage museum, showcasing artifacts and exhibits that illustrate the history of donkeys in Cyprus. From their role in agriculture and transportation to their significance in local folklore, the museum provides a comprehensive overview of the donkey's impact on Cypriot society. The farm also demonstrates traditional crafts, offering a hands-on experience of the island's cultural heritage.
